Hello,
It's been a long time since the last po4a release. So I intend to release
po4a 0.35 in nearly 10 days (February 9).
As usual, if you need more time to update the translations, just let me
know. I can change the date, or plan a dot-release afterwards.
If you want a feature or bug fix in 0.35, please raise your hand.
On Debian, this release will be uploaded to experimental to avoid
interferences (string changes) with the Lenny release, but this release
should be considered stable enough for inclusion in other distributions.
There have been significant changes in the Xml and even more in the
Docbook modules. I would appreciate if you could test the Docbook module
in advance.
I made some tests with aptitude, which uses the docbook module for its
documentation. It makes a few string changes, but I think these are
improvements. I do not expect the update to be a hard task (however, I
don't think it can be automated).
Here are the current status of the translations:
================================================
Translations of the binaries:
-----------------------------
af 22t 12f 143u
ar 1t 176u
bn 4t 2f 171u
ca 147t 8f 22u
cs 124t 27f 26u
de 59t 22f 96u
eo 34t 7f 136u
es 147t 8f 22u
et 71t 16f 90u
eu 11t 2f 164u
fr 171t 6u
he 3t 1f 173u
hr 30t 4f 143u
id 132t 17f 28u
it 136t 17f 24u
ja 67t 36f 74u
kn 33t 8f 136u
ko 20t 1f 156u
ku 4t 1f 172u
nb 51t 19f 107u
nl 20t 6f 151u
oc 4t 5f 168u
pl 170t 1f 6u
pt_BR 41t 11f 125u
pt 10t 2f 165u
ru 170t 1f 6u
sl 6t 8f 163u
sv 133t 12f 32u
uk 4t 6f 167u
uz 5t 172u
zh_CN 14t 1f 162u
zh_HK 16t 6f 155u
You can find the PO files in:
http://alioth.debian.org/plugins/scmcvs/cvsweb.php/po4a/po/bin/?cvsroot=po4a
Translations of the man pages:
------------------------------
ca.po 820t 123f 251u
es.po 820t 123f 251u
fr.po 1151t 11f 32u
it.po 272t 109f 813u
ja.po 1181t 6f 7u
pl.po 1146t 25f 23u
You can find the PO files in:
http://alioth.debian.org/plugins/scmcvs/cvsweb.php/po4a/po/pod/?cvsroot=po4a
The major changes for this release are:
=======================================
po4a
* Added support for the [po_directory] command in the configuration file.
It permits to avoid listing the supported languages. Simply dropping a
new PO file should be sufficient. It should be preferred over the
po4a_langs and po4a_paths commands.
po4a-normalize:
* Added option -b, --blank to check which parts of a document are not
translated.
po4a-gettextize:
* Improved conflict handling: indicate the reference of the alternatives
when the same string has different translations.
general:
* Added support for a nowrapi18n option in Locale::Po4a::Common in
order to use Locale::Po4a programatically.
Docbook:
* Improved support for Docbook 5 and Docbook 4, based on the official
documentation of the Docbook tags.
Sgml:
* Add support for recursive inclusion.
Text:
* Added option asciidoc
Xhtml:
* Improvements for the <u> tag.
xml:
* Fix the nodefault option. Derivative modules should use _default_tags
and _default_inline to define the default behavior of their
module-specific tags (instead of tags and inline).
* Speed improvements.
* Added support for placeholders.
Kind Regards,
--
Nekral